Installation
If you're in the market to replace a gas fire, or you're installing an entirely new fireplace it should be performed by a gas fire engineer Near me Safe registered professional. It is a complex procedure that requires a careful reconnection to your gas system and a thorough examination of your new fireplace in order to ensure that it is in compliance with Building Regulations.
Your heating engineer will then have to determine the size of your room. The size of your room will determine if you are able to safely install a gas fireplace. It will also affect where, what kind, and how many vents you can install.
Once your measurements are complete After that, the heating engineer will set up your new fire. They'll install the appliance on an external wall with an outlet for the evacuation of exhaust gases and an enduring base. Then they will connect it to the main line of gas and heating engineer and test the operation. They'll then put it together any hearth or surround that you have selected. Depending on the type of fire you're using, you may need to install a chimney or a flue liner as well.
